WASHINGTON D.C. — (02-03-21) — Secretary of Transportation Pete Buttigieg made history today being sworn in as the first openly gay cabinet secretary by Vice President Kamala Harris this morning in the Eisenhower Executive Office Building.

Second Gentleman Doug Emhoff and Chasten Buttigieg were in attendance for this historic occasion.

In a masked ceremony, vice president Kamala Harris led now Secretary of Transportation Pete Buttigieg through the oath as he swore to support and defend the Constitution of the United States.

The vice president cheerfully congratulated Secretary Buttigieg and gave him the customary COVID-19 protocol of the elbow-bump.

Vice President Harris’s office release photos of the ceremony.

Secretary Buttigieg’s responsibilities will be to serve as principal adviser to president Biden in all matters relating to federal transportation programs. His office oversees the formulation of national transportation policy and promotes intermodal transportation.
